Glow ionic nitriding furnace includes ionic triding and lon-carbonitriding .glow ionic nitriding furnace can significantly enhances the surface hardness of steel parts,resistance to damage,fatigue and corrosion;because it has the advantages for energy saving, save gas, high efficiency, good quality, no pollution, etc. It has been applied widely in power, machine tools, petrochemical machinery, textile machinery, mold and other industries.

As a chemical heat treatment method to strengthen the metal surface, ion nitriding is widely used in cast iron, carbon steel alloy steel, stainless steel and titanium alloy. After the parts are treated by ion nitriding, the hardness of the surface of the material can be sign if cantly improved, so that it has higher wear resistance, fatigue strength, corrosion resistance and burn resistance. Ion nitriding is a new nit riding method that c merged in the 1970s. compared with gas nit riding, it has fast nitriding speed, easy control of nit riding layer structure, low brittleness, no environmental pollution, energy saving, and small gas energy and deformation. 1. What is the different about Nitriding furnace and Vaccum furnace?
Ion nitriding, also known as glow nitriding, is carried out using the principle of glow discharge. Ion nitriding is to use the metal workpiece as the cathode furnace body as the anode in a low-vacuum furnace filled with nitrogen gas. After being energized, the nitrogen and hydrogen atoms in the medium are ionized under the high-voltage DC electric field, forming a plasma region between the cathodes. to adsorption and diffusion, nitrogen penetrates into the surface of the workpiece.
Under the action of a strong electric field in the plasma area, the positive ions of nitrogen and hydrogen bombard the surface of the workpiece at a high speed. The high kinetic energy of ions is converted into thermal energy, heating the surface of the workpiece to the required temperature. Due to the bombardment of ions, atomic sputtering is generated on the surface of the workpiece, which is purified. At the same time, due to adsorption and diffusion, nitrogen penetrates into the surface of the
workpiece.
The gas nitridingsystem workpiece is placed in the furnace, and the NH3 gas is directly injected into the nitride furnace at 500 to 550ºC, which is maintained for 20 to 100 hours, so that NH3 gas is decomposed into atomic (N) gas and (H) gas for nitriding. The main purpose is to produce a wear-resistant and corrosion-resistant compound layer on the surface of the steel.
2. Precautions for ion nitriding
The cleaning workpiece is nitridized with gas, but it is best to dry or cool and then put it into the furnace to save arcing time. The workpiece should be evenly loaded into the furnace. The interval between the workpiece and the cathode and anode must be more than 30mm, so as to avoid the excessive current density between the two poles and the local temperature of the workpiece being too high. Do a good job of anti-seepage. Any hole less than 2mm must be shielded, and the sample must be placed in a position that can be consistent with the temperature of the workpiece.
3.What kind of work piece can be use with Nitriding furnace ?
4Cr5MoSiV1(H13),3Cr3Mo3W2V,5Cr4W5Mo2V ,20 steel,40 steel,20Cr,20CrMnTi,40Cr/38CrMoAl,42CrMo, 50CrV,,1Cr18Ni9Ti,40 steel,alloy structural steel, bearing steel, spring steel, die steel, tool steel and other materials.
4. What's the max temperature nitriding furnace working for ?
Normal steel working temperature around 520-550 degree,if the Titanium alloy heating temperature must be around 750-800 degrees,this is customized type,you can inquire our sales technical manage.
